Abstract
Climate change is a global phenomenon that has significant impacts on ecosystems worldwide, including tropical rainforests. This research project focuses on analyzing the impact of climate change on plant species diversity in a tropical rainforest ecosystem. The study aims to investigate how changes in temperature, precipitation patterns, and other climatic factors affect the distribution and abundance of plant species within the rainforest. The research begins with a comprehensive review of existing literature on climate change and its effects on plant species diversity in tropical rainforests. This review provides a theoretical foundation for understanding the potential mechanisms driving changes in plant communities in response to climatic shifts. The methodology chapter outlines the research design and data collection methods employed in the study. Field surveys, vegetation sampling, and data analysis techniques are utilized to assess the current plant species composition and diversity in the study area. Climate data, including temperature and precipitation records, are also collected and analyzed to investigate the relationship between climatic variables and plant species diversity. Results from the field surveys and data analysis are presented in the findings chapter. The study reveals correlations between specific climatic factors and changes in plant species richness, evenness, and composition. These findings contribute to a deeper understanding of how climate change influences plant communities in tropical rainforests. The discussion chapter interprets the results in the context of existing scientific knowledge and theories related to climate change impacts on ecosystems. The implications of the findings for biodiversity conservation and ecosystem management are discussed, highlighting the importance of considering climate change in conservation planning and policy-making. In conclusion, this research project provides valuable insights into the impact of climate change on plant species diversity in a tropical rainforest ecosystem. By identifying the relationships between climatic variables and plant communities, the study contributes to our understanding of how environmental changes influence biodiversity in sensitive ecosystems. Future research directions are suggested to further explore the long-term effects of climate change on tropical rainforest plant species and to develop effective conservation strategies in response to these challenges.

Project Overview

The project titled "Analysis of the Impact of Climate Change on Plant Species Diversity in a Tropical Rainforest Ecosystem" aims to investigate the effects of climate change on plant species diversity within tropical rainforest ecosystems. Tropical rainforests are known for their high biodiversity, with a wide array of plant species coexisting in these complex ecosystems. However, the increasing effects of climate change, such as rising temperatures, altered precipitation patterns, and extreme weather events, pose significant threats to the stability and diversity of plant communities in these sensitive environments. The study will focus on assessing how climate change influences plant species richness, composition, and distribution in a specific tropical rainforest ecosystem. By examining these factors, the research aims to provide valuable insights into the resilience of plant communities to changing environmental conditions and the potential implications for ecosystem functioning and biodiversity conservation efforts. Through a combination of field surveys, data analysis, and modeling techniques, the project will explore the relationships between climate variables and plant species diversity parameters. It will also investigate the mechanisms driving changes in plant community dynamics in response to climate change stressors. By identifying key patterns and trends, the study seeks to enhance our understanding of the complex interactions between climate change and plant species diversity in tropical rainforests. The research findings are expected to contribute to the existing body of knowledge on the impacts of climate change on biodiversity and ecosystem dynamics, particularly in tropical regions. The outcomes of this study may inform conservation strategies, land management practices, and policy initiatives aimed at mitigating the adverse effects of climate change on plant communities and promoting their long-term sustainability in tropical rainforest ecosystems. Overall, this research project underscores the importance of studying the effects of climate change on plant species diversity in tropical rainforest ecosystems and highlights the need for proactive measures to safeguard these valuable and diverse ecosystems in the face of ongoing environmental challenges.
